Roth IRAs don’t offer a direct tax deduction for contributions. Rolling into a Roth implies you’ll pay taxes on the rolled amount, unless you’re rolling over a Roth 401(k). The upside is the fact withdrawals in retirement are tax-free after age fifty nine½.

For example, you are taking a distribution by check and deposit Those people funds into a private bank account. You then produce a check from that account and ship it in your ira rollover acceptance letter new IRA supplier within sixty days of your First distribution to deposit to the account- this is surely an indirect rollover.
